From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from firstgate.proxmox.com (firstgate.proxmox.com [212.224.123.68]) by lore.proxmox.com (Postfix) with ESMTPS id A00CE1FF176 for ; Fri, 21 Feb 2025 16:41:56 +0100 (CET) Received: from firstgate.proxmox.com (localhost [127.0.0.1]) by firstgate.proxmox.com (Proxmox) with ESMTP id 463815E38; Fri, 21 Feb 2025 16:41:48 +0100 (CET)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=web.de; s=s29768273; t=1740152468; x=1740757268; i=devzero@web.de; bh=rI3qbzIw+MywkBUEJMfD6CPGXMkVtMSyO0uwfu5Vpx8=; h=X-UI-Sender-Class:Message-ID:Date:MIME-Version:Subject:To: References:From:In-Reply-To:Content-Type: Content-Transfer-Encoding:cc:content-transfer-encoding: content-type:date:from:message-id:mime-version:reply-to:subject: to; b=jEPsvtLWRgZu33NZYrNvhGcOz1lgXpxLRKvHh7Y2i8vn2pgCfjRyLdr3PxHy3j6C GoVphYtj8QFNOV0JpDnP2vaV1ZziNwOGOwzBMqvHVX9o7PVlThzflYKiPipalJy6U OrqZ2TUFDnoGPCQh++7wzJ0duh6IZ4Xf6PgxXz9+RJjay1lKYkmJCvisskPsaXuwY 46FbOtp4i5TXGIVq0vmSInSrhee4M2JB70+6fN5Jqymf6IJppTZnZaD7KXkg35Nc/ 2dDeTa9Rq2UEUAjaVEy7F35g5csFxBSq/pIDAoC1nSeiETlaBaw0AkEXi40FXyDXQ 9LAnJCo7i7n+ZQskQQ== X-UI-Sender-Class: 814a7b36-bfc1-4dae-8640-3722d8ec6cd6 Message-ID: Date: Fri, 21 Feb 2025 16:35:46 +0100 MIME-Version: 1.0 User-Agent: Mozilla Thunderbird To: Proxmox Backup Server development discussion , Christian Ebner References: <20250221140110.377328-1-c.ebner@proxmox.com> From: Roland In-Reply-To: <20250221140110.377328-1-c.ebner@proxmox.com> X-Provags-ID: V03:K1:K9KYsok8gmv8xb4+mUOx27GZEhDSgV6PF/Trr3JYVeJ4gt6GlEE +7rYeqQ0hLCwgJMOZWUryogYAFf+ZLnGm06Sfw3kU00/UZWRScYCiZ5sRPCWSHwTCKDb9AY SLxEF9aEyu8Hem/WTYLOhi7zTX9CHq2A9EZTHGpH4Dzxb50Unn9IaiW3BJ9AwTUxD1wRKZl EuDL01Z32ZTOMCx7yHCTA== X-Spam-Flag: NO UI-OutboundReport: notjunk:1;M01:P0:/Mx19epuu04=;yS+bIS6etBM1VbcwCZm6vBmRTqR VQZ0Hjo76LSSJJ9uT7WZVYX7/nq6u7M8AKZ7X6rEFHMAJFSiVkgQhtKlTJVWHgjMf1JyA0v0P ajvRYUQnX5UqU/ru8GLmU+z8sAebfHHJvywpDZwPTDhja7d3hYj9ZtnZdhGAI7gRijPq3tma5 RU3duHNAh25EKP4v1UJDi4wIuBOXoIcqmmvNnpK0QuaaK075WWJtbX9gpaFLDbyeBV9MCBFuR +x9dvGCAHOjkMZM9SEW7W5nWhxWZ2WUo4DFGivG3uJ/Dl3GxMTipJxcYwezPxjgZY+7oDELCB BGzNav0Vg/Y7KwznOgsV9Lm9Si2cBJXEaM6l290oj/MbyccM4eAIpT1kRK+SeoH0nZ/UZ6U7o ftJFnQAQvm+JUlCHYlToGyWbgr4ZwxRxvjjDhVl6wqBpsU9zM1oK1O9ZJh5E0pq7Olva4ZQHA F9aNZYf+GAskVoSh4Lj58IA/v7xTPupjKh0UUpQpTGKK0k9OpldwIF/bwdFU2uEkXuxLp9ASp 9yjcx3Hcuw8Bk/Yf0Auacc3MF49EtRwQ7xzPQYRh+vg1Ug6bLfGtEHocg/uqjUDl4f1YisqrJ fbqEE6l9yn5mBjSx4379fokf4Uqxn5e/PqpnLJDnuxmO0IFA7lhv1ScW9fvwdlrItoXS/RGN8 FbpIFX0+pd034qNxPV5qPfU8yLso8W5dVKmiVJ63m74/Das1Tkqqj0cf/pqHF9XjR/rKcHWQj dOXFvCkhWc/vwdSygBog9gtLQl4W9FZJFJQn7SN5txDhO5O6wbVGmjwRnGy3U6JgfKaTkXVTp cixWkrhKS7TZh20XAt7eXqsymq5xrMMt6ZsYhlxubHMIiyVpA1m7hRTJO6kA4mT+NVX8j73M1 dmV3jgXh7IipvVHTqLVFN3KwYgpfxBIEMwkVzZxnZkbB7AFZ8DsCZ13SIuiNGPG0StOcZs0Cn q2V15G7+mmPSoVyV7rYY4G7ycQYE9ztw7ev02ZvHGDe0HRCKwwGoquDPk9ivDx2se9g9xKDk2 iebc/R9+9YBPggNdkT2oGhRWd5XvqU0l4vWALfqUk99fOjNUo2iX/j2Z/XE7bWZebTzMhIAVh W3pvQc6ceVyNeyuwFqy1+N2WaZshqS6dybm1ZPNHkHTa9g3al0CNwQDTlWh15vlDVzt199ynI lAZCyNRjU9m9PO4RKZE+xCRa+dwFzEwWWuF+BjAnwSkT83hTSjQjPwuDZ9Dzn3sQjR/zvAyOq IpK7YaYc6L9cqbk7AWTtCWPdcs/5CQe9suMCM0J2FNwzzxlZTzzFwoOBXTRnx9OD4DyldxdIW zwIbad8yviazn1KUVjnWlHvs9l0EZYcUY/doWEiL1b79U2eSJkt0UB7EO84cmDnyK+q9FvUGV ZyBHjrMtJCevadFVi1mIlWr69X1nwvuGW4DNu06qSwVbLygeltx6KeHYsj X-SPAM-LEVEL: Spam detection results: 0 AWL 1.019 Adjusted score from AWL reputation of From: address BAYES_00 -1.9 Bayes spam probability is 0 to 1% DKIM_SIGNED 0.1 Message has a DKIM or DK signature, not necessarily valid DKIM_VALID -0.1 Message has at least one valid DKIM or DK signature DKIM_VALID_AU -0.1 Message has a valid DKIM or DK signature from author's domain DKIM_VALID_EF -0.1 Message has a valid DKIM or DK signature from envelope-from domain DMARC_PASS -0.1 DMARC pass policy FREEMAIL_FROM 0.001 Sender email is commonly abused enduser mail provider POISEN_SPAM_PILL_3 0.1 random spam to be learned in bayes RCVD_IN_DNSWL_LOW -0.7 Sender listed at https://www.dnswl.org/, low trust RCVD_IN_MSPIKE_H3 0.001 Good reputation (+3) RCVD_IN_MSPIKE_WL 0.001 Mailspike good senders RCVD_IN_VALIDITY_CERTIFIED_BLOCKED 0.001 ADMINISTRATOR NOTICE: The query to Validity was blocked. See https://knowledge.validity.com/hc/en-us/articles/20961730681243 for more information. RCVD_IN_VALIDITY_RPBL_BLOCKED 0.001 ADMINISTRATOR NOTICE: The query to Validity was blocked. See https://knowledge.validity.com/hc/en-us/articles/20961730681243 for more information. RCVD_IN_VALIDITY_SAFE_BLOCKED 0.001 ADMINISTRATOR NOTICE: The query to Validity was blocked. See https://knowledge.validity.com/hc/en-us/articles/20961730681243 for more information. SPF_HELO_NONE 0.001 SPF: HELO does not publish an SPF Record SPF_PASS -0.001 SPF: sender matches SPF record URIBL_BLOCKED 0.001 ADMINISTRATOR NOTICE: The query to URIBL was blocked. See http://wiki.apache.org/spamassassin/DnsBlocklists#dnsbl-block for more information. [datastore.rs, proxmox.com] Subject: Re: [pbs-devel] [PATCH proxmox-backup 0/5] GC: avoid multiple atime updates X-BeenThere: pbs-devel@lists.proxmox.com X-Mailman-Version: 2.1.29 Precedence: list List-Id: Proxmox Backup Server development discussion List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-To: Proxmox Backup Server development discussion Content-Transfer-Encoding: base64 Content-Type: text/plain; charset="utf-8"; Format="flowed" Errors-To: pbs-devel-bounces@lists.proxmox.com Sender: "pbs-devel" aGVsbG8sCgp0aGlzIGxvb2tzIGxpa2UgdGhpcyByZWxhdGVzIHRvIG9yIGFkcmVzc2VzIHdoYXQn cyBiZWluZyBtZW50aW9uZWQgaGVyZSA/CgpodHRwczovL2ZvcnVtLnByb3htb3guY29tL3RocmVh ZHMvYmV0dGVyLXVuZGVyc3RhbmQtcHJveG1veC1nYXJiYWdlLWNvbGxlY3Rpb24tbG90cy1vZi1h dm9pZGFibGUtdXRpbWVuc2F0LWNhbGxzLjEwMTQxNy8KPwoKaXQgY2FtZSB0byBteSBtaW5kIHdo ZW4gcmVhZGluZyB0aGlzLsKgIG5vdCBzdXJlIGlmIGkgZGlkIGFuIFJGRSBmb3IKdGhpcywgZ3Vl c3MgaSBmb3Jnb3QuLi4KCiA+Zm9yIG15IGN1cmlvc2l0eSwgaSBzZWUgdGhlcmUgaXMgb25lIGNo dW5rIGluIGJvdGggb2YgbXkgaG9tZXNlcnZlcgpyZXBvcyB3aGljaCBpcyBhY2Nlc3NlZCBvcmRl cnMgb2YgbWFnbml0dWRlcyBtb3JlIG9mdGVuIHRoZW4gYWxsCiA+dGhlIG90aGVyIGNodW5rcyAo Zm9yIG9uZSByZXBvIHJvdW5kYWJvdXQgMTAwMHggbW9yZSBvZnRlbikgZHVyaW5nIGdjCnJ1bi4g YW55aG93LCBtYW55IGNodW5rcyBhcmUgYmVpbmcgYWNlc3NlZCByZXBlYXRlZGx5LCBidXQgYXQg YSBtdWNoCmxvd2VyIHJhdGUuCgphaCwgbm93IGkgdW5kZXJzdGFuZCB3aHkgdGhhdCBmaWxlIGlz IHRvdWNoZWQgMzQ3NDIgdGltZXMgLSBpdCdzIHRoYXQKImFsbCB6ZXJvZXMiIGNodW5rLCB3aGlj aCBkb2VzIG9jY3VyIGluIHRoZSB2bSBpbWFnZSBtdWNoIG1vcmUgb2Z0ZW4uCgozNDc0MiBwcm94 bW94LWJhY2t1cC0oMTQyOCk6IFIKL2JhY2t1cC9wdmUtdDYyMF9iYWNrdXAvLmNodW5rcy9iYjlm L2JiOWY4ZGY2MTQ3NGQyNWU3MWZhMDA3MjIzMThjZDM4NzM5NmNhMTczNjYwNWUxMjQ4ODIxY2Mw ZGUzZDNhZjgKCmFueSBjbHVlIHdoYXQncyB0aGlzIG9uZSzCoCB3aGljaCBpcyBiZWluZyB0b3Vj aGVkIGFuIG9yZGVyIG9mIG1hZ25pdHVkZQptb3JlIG9mdGVuIHRoZW4gdGhlIHplcm9lcyBjaHVu ayA/Cgo5NDAwNzkgcHJveG1veC1iYWNrdXAtKDE0MjgpOiBSCi9iYWNrdXAvcHZlLW1ha2VyLWJv bm5fYmFja3VwLy5jaHVua3MvN2IyNy83YjI3YjFlYjRmZWJhZTMyNzMzMjEyNTVkODMwNGU5YjNl NzkzOGQ5ZTI1NDU2NGJlZjg1OWE0MzA3YTg4NjM4CgpyZWdhcmRzCnJvbGFuZAoKCkFtIDIxLjAy LjI1IHVtIDE1OjAxIHNjaHJpZWIgQ2hyaXN0aWFuIEVibmVyOgo+IFRoaXMgcGF0Y2hlcyBpbXBs ZW1lbnQgdGhlIGxvZ2ljIHRvIGdyZWF0bHkgaW1wcm92ZSB0aGUgcGVyZm9ybWFuY2UKPiBvZiBw aGFzZSAxIGdhcmJhZ2UgY29sbGVjdGlvbiBieSBhdm9pZGluZyBtdWx0aXBsZSBhdGltZSB1cGRh dGVzIG9uCj4gdGhlIHNhbWUgY2h1bmsuCj4KPiBDdXJyZW50bHksIHBoYXNlIDEgR0MgaXRlcmF0 ZXMgb3ZlciBhbGwgZm9sZGVycyBpbiB0aGUgZGF0YXN0b3JlCj4gbG9va2luZyBhbmQgY29sbGVj dGluZyBhbGwgaW1hZ2UgaW5kZXggZmlsZXMgd2l0aG91dCB0YWtpbmcgYW55Cj4gbG9naWNhbCBh c3N1bXB0aW9ucyAoZS5nLiBuYW1lc3BhY2VzLCBncm91cHMsIHNuYXBzaG90cywgLi4uKS4gVGhp cwo+IGlzIHRvIGF2b2lkIGFjY2lkZW50YWxseSBtaXNzaW5nIGltYWdlIGluZGV4IGZpbGVzIGxv Y2F0ZWQgaW4KPiB1bmV4cGVjdGVkIHBhdGhzIGFuZCB0aGVyZWZvcmUgbm90IG1hcmtpbmcgdGhl aXIgY2h1bmtzIGFzIGluIHVzZSwKPiBsZWFkaW5nIHRvIHBvdGVudGlhbCBkYXRhIGxvc3Nlcy4K Pgo+IFRoaXMgcGF0Y2hlcyBpbXByb3ZlIHBoYXNlIDEgYnkgaW5zZXJ0aW5nIGVuY291bnRlcmVk IGluZGV4IGltYWdlCj4gcGF0aHMgaW50byBhIGRhdGEgc3RydWN0dXJlIHdoaWNoIGFsbG93cyB0 byBpdGVyYXRlIHRoZSBpbmRleCBmaWxlcwo+IGluIGEgbW9yZSBsb2dpY2FsIG1hbm5lciwgZm9s bG93aW5nIHRoZSBzYW1lIHByaW5jaXBsZSBhcyBmb3IKPiBpbmNyZW1lbnRhbCBiYWNrdXAgc25h cHNob3RzLiBUaGUgaW5kZXggZmlsZXMgZm9yIHRoZSBzYW1lIG5hbWVzcGFjZQo+IGFuZCBncm91 cCBhcyB3ZWxsIGFzIGltYWdlIGZpbGVuYW1lIGNhbiB0aGVyZWZvcmUgYmUgY29uc2VjdXRldmx5 Cj4gaW5zcGVjdGVkLgo+Cj4gRnVydGhlciwgYnkga2VlcGluZyB0cmFjayBvZiBhbHJlYWR5IHNl ZW4gYW5kIHRoZXJlZm9yZSB1cGRhdGVkIGNodW5rCj4gYXRpbWVzLCBpdCBpcyBub3cgYXZvaWRl ZCB0byB1cGRhdGUgdGhlIGF0aW1lIG92ZXIgYW5kIG92ZXIgYWdhaW4gb24gdGhlCj4gY2h1bmtz IHNoYXJlZCBieSBjb25zZWN1dGl2ZSBiYWNrdXAgc25hcGhzaG90cy4KPgo+IFRvIGdpdmUgc29t ZSBiYWxscGFyayBmaWd1cmVzLCB0aGlzIHJlZHVjZWQgcGhhc2UgMSBnYXJiYWdlIGNvbGxlY3Rp b24KPiBvbiBhIHJlYWwgd29ybGQgZGF0YXN0b3JlIGNvbnRhaW5pbmcgc29tZSBvZiBteSBiYWNr dXBzIGZyb20gYXJvdW5kCj4gMiBtaW51dGVzIHRvIGFib3V0IDE2IHNlY29uZHMuCj4KPiBDaHJp c3RpYW4gRWJuZXIgKDUpOgo+ICAgIGRhdGFzdG9yZTogcmVzdHJpY3QgZGF0YXN0b3JlcyBsaXN0 X2ltYWdlcyBtZXRob2Qgc2NvcGUgdG8gbW9kdWxlCj4gICAgZ2FyYmFnZSBjb2xsZWN0aW9uOiBy ZWZhY3RvciBhcmNoaXZlIHR5cGUgYmFzZWQgY2h1bmsgbWFya2luZyBsb2dpYwo+ICAgIGdhcmJh Z2UgY29sbGVjdGlvbjogYWRkIHN0cnVjdHVyZSBmb3Igb3B0aW1pemVkIGltYWdlIGl0ZXJhdGlv bgo+ICAgIGdhcmJhZ2UgY29sbGVjdGlvbjogYWxsb3cgdG8ga2VlcCB0cmFjayBvZiBhbHJlYWR5 IHRvdWNoZWQgY2h1bmtzCj4gICAgZml4ICM1MzMxOiBnYXJiYWdlIGNvbGxlY3Rpb246IGF2b2lk IG11bHRpcGxlIGNodW5rIGF0aW1lIHVwZGF0ZXMKPgo+ICAgcGJzLWRhdGFzdG9yZS9zcmMvZGF0 YXN0b3JlLnJzIHwgMjA0ICsrKysrKysrKysrKysrKysrKysrKysrKysrLS0tLS0tLQo+ICAgMSBm aWxlIGNoYW5nZWQsIDE2MCBpbnNlcnRpb25zKCspLCA0NCBkZWxldGlvbnMoLSkKPgoKX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X18KcGJzLWRldmVsIG1haWxp bmcgbGlzdApwYnMtZGV2ZWxAbGlzdHMucHJveG1veC5jb20KaHR0cHM6Ly9saXN0cy5wcm94bW94 LmNvbS9jZ2ktYmluL21haWxtYW4vbGlzdGluZm8vcGJzLWRldmVsCg==